The Bond: A Dramatic Poem is a literary work written by Catherine Grace Frances Moody Gore and published in 1824. The book is a dramatic poem that tells the story of a young woman named Isidore de Courcy who is forced to marry a man she does not love. The plot revolves around the theme of love, betrayal, and revenge. The book is set in the 18th century and explores the social norms and expectations of the time. The characters are well-developed and the language used is poetic and lyrical.
